    Profile summary

    Reporting to the Vice-Chancellor, Chris provides strategic leadership across the 3 schools of the faculty and is responsible for ensuring the faculty delivers excellence across all aspects of education and the student experience, research and innovation. His role includes:

    • Executive leadership of the Schools of Computing, Engineering and Mathematics; Geography, Earth and Environmental Sciences; and Biological and Marine Sciences.
    • Membership of key institutional bodies, including Senate; Academic Development and Partnership Committee; IT and Digital Committee; University Equality, Diversity & Inclusion Committee; UEG Risk Review Group
    • University Executive Chair Sustainability Advisory Group
    • University Executive Chair University of Plymouth Technicians Commitment
    • Member of the UKRI Talent Peer Review College
    • Member of the Australian Research Council peer review college
    • Adjunct Professor UNSW Australia

    Chris joined the University of Plymouth in 2024, from Cranfield University where he was Pro-Vice Chancellor for the School of Water, Energy and the Environment. Chris has a background in climate science and Earth Systems modelling. Beyond his specialist field he has helped develop and deliver some of the most innovative low-carbon ‘at scale’ energy demonstration projects in Europe.
